Data Community Lead

At The Millson Group, our Data Community Lead plays a central role in helping organizations build strong, scalable, and empowered analytics cultures.

This role bridges the gap between technical data infrastructure and business-facing insights, ensuring that data is not only accessible and reliable, but also actively adopted across teams. From designing modern reporting environments to training users in everyday analytics tools, the Data Community Lead helps companies turn data into a shared capability, not a siloed function.

Key Focus Areas

  • Analytics & Business Intelligence Enablement
    Lead the development and adoption of analytics tools such as Power BI, Excel, and enterprise reporting platforms to support decision-making across the organization.

  • Data Infrastructure to Visualization
    Support the full analytics pipeline—from SQL-based data modeling and transformation through dashboarding, KPI reporting, and executive-ready insights.

  • Training & Community Building
    Create internal data communities through hands-on training, documentation, and support that empowers teams to confidently use and develop analytics in their daily work.

  • Standardization & Best Practices
    Establish reporting standards, governance practices, and scalable analytics frameworks that ensure consistency, accuracy, and long-term growth.

  • Cross-Functional Collaboration
    Partner with business leaders, operations teams, and technical stakeholders to align analytics initiatives with organizational priorities.

Impact

The Data Community Lead helps clients move beyond isolated reporting toward a culture where data is understood, trusted, and actively used throughout the organization. By combining technical expertise with enablement and leadership, this role ensures analytics becomes a lasting capability—not just a project deliverable.
